> Thanks for pointing this out, I wasn't aware of this latest glibc fix.
> Here's an updated definition (for both stdint.h and wchar.h). If it
> looks good I'll update the patch, assuming the rest of the ongoing
> discussion doesn't change this snippet further. To summarize other
> discussions, the code first relies on the compiler's own defines
> (__WCHAR_{MIN,MAX}__) and stdint.h/wchar.h includes (which could
> define WCHAR_{MIN,MAX}) to do the right thing. If that fails then
> AFAICT we're stuck with making an educated guess as to what the
> "right" value is, and in some cases that guess will necessarily be
> wrong because we can't use casts. Newlib's current guess (before my
> patch) is 32-bits, so I decided to stick to that and I don't think
> going with 16-bits is any better (it's also wrong in some cases, but
> now it's also different from what previous newlib versions used to
> guess!).
>
> I'm of course open to suggestions here, but I'm not seeing a better
> solution and hope someone else sees one.
There is a better way than guessing, but it is ugly:  add a configure-time check 
that determines what the value is and puts it into the generated newlib.h (in a 
manner analogous to how _LDBL_EQ_DBL is, for example).

> #ifndef WCHAR_MIN
> #ifdef __WCHAR_MIN__
> #define WCHAR_MIN __WCHAR_MIN__
> #elif defined(__WCHAR_UNSIGNED__) || (L'\0' - 1 > 0)
> #define WCHAR_MIN (0 + L'\0')
> #else
> #define WCHAR_MIN (-0x7fffffff - 1 + L'\0')
> #endif
> #endif
>
> #ifndef WCHAR_MAX
> #ifdef __WCHAR_MAX__
> #define WCHAR_MAX __WCHAR_MAX__
> #elif defined(__WCHAR_UNSIGNED__) || (L'\0' - 1 > 0)
> #define WCHAR_MAX (0xffffffffu + L'\0')
> #else
> #define WCHAR_MAX (0x7fffffffu + L'\0')
> #endif
The present wchar.h is broken in this manner already for WCHAR_MAX, so it might 
not be unreasonable to do this for wchar.h now and follow up with a fix for the 
existing MAX issue.  It probably is not good, however, to add the breakage to 
stdint.h.
